    Import Photos Panel has a check "Remove items after importing" below the toolbar. If you enable this, before importing items, they will be automatically deleted.

    You don't see this check box, because you have activated on your iPhone photo library iCloud.  As long as you use iCloud photo library, the Mac cannot delete the photos, because they are stored in iCloud and only mirrored on your iPhone.

    "Remove items after importation" is to risk anyway. I would not use this option. First, it is safer to check if the import was successful before deleting the photos from the iPhone.  Sometimes it happens that photos will be removed from the device, even if the import was not successful.

    So why would I back up my photos to a photo library. Yes, I could go through frame by frame making sure that they are all there, but there are more than 2500 and would prefer to delete automatically the picures copied after importation. Make sense?

    Since all the pictures are in the library of iCloud, download them by creating a new library of Photos on your Mac and enable it in your library to iCloud.  It will download all photos in iCloud.

    You are you sure, that all the photos are safely on your Mac, disable iCloud photo library on your iPhone.  Then you can connect the iPhone to a USB port and use Image Capture to remove all the photos from the iPhone.

    You can also download pictures from iCloud by using the web interface of your iCloud to www.icloud.com account.  Launch the Photos.app on this page and select the photos to download.

    Someone has a misunderstanding about Lightroom and its import process. Importing images into Lightroom does not mean that Lightroom will ingest these images. The import process is one of saying Lightroom where to store the images on the hard drive. Then Lightroom keeps track of these images in this folder location and combines the image settings. If the images were imported in the usual way, they should be located in a folder on the hard disk.

    If you say that the images were just imported while remaining on the map (I thought that Lightroom who wouldn't) then if they have not been copied to the hard drive you will have images. Just previews.

    You can launch the Image Capture.app and import the photos in a folder in the Finder and then import this file into iPhoto.  If you use the transfer of images, you can always remove distributed after importation.

    But in fact, it is not recommended to remove the pictures from the camera before convince you yourself, that the imported photos have been transferred without transmission mistakes and make the first backup. I've seen quite a few posts here, where iPhoto crashed during importation or imported photos have been corrupt and if that happens, you will not be able to resume the transfer, if you let iPhoto delete photos immediately.
